John Wayne Airport Posts May 2025 Statistics

(SANTA ANA, CA) - Airline passenger traffic at John Wayne Airport increased in May 2025 as compared to May 2024. In May 2025, the Airport served 980,663 passengers, an increase of 3.1% when compared with the May 2024 passenger traffic count of 950,740.

Commercial aircraft operations in May 2025 of 8,187 increased 4.1% and commuter aircraft operations of 705 increased 67.9% when comparing with 2024 levels. 

Total aircraft operations increased in May 2025 as compared with the same month in 2024. In May 2025, there were 30,464 total aircraft operations (takeoffs and landings) a 21.6% increase compared to 25,061 total aircraft operations in May 2024.

General aviation activity of 21,530 accounted for 70.7% of the total aircraft operations during May 2025, and increased 28.7% compared with May 2024.

The top three airlines in May 2025 based on passenger count were Southwest Airlines (267,982), American Airlines (169,152), and United Airlines (156,342).
